Utilize Nooks and Crannies

When it comes to storage and efficiency in small and unconventional kitchen spaces, it’s important to get creative and utilize every nook and cranny. One idea is to install pull-out racks in corner cabinets, which not only makes access easier but also helps keep space that would otherwise be wasted. Narrow spaces, such as those next to appliances or between cabinets, can be utilized for spice racks or hanging pots and pans. Another option is to add built-in shelving between appliances or even above the refrigerator. This is a great way to store items that might not fit in standard cabinets, such as oversized pots or mixing bowls. Take Advantage of Cabinet Doors

Cabinet doors help with utilizing space in kitchens as well. This extra space can be used for organizing items such as spices, utensils, and even pots and pans. To make the most of this space, it’s best to use wire baskets, racks, or shelves. These items are easy to attach to the inside of cabinet doors and can be found in a variety of sizes to fit your specific needs. However, it’s important to consider the weight capacity of your cabinet doors when choosing how to organize items. Heavy items such as cast iron pans may require additional support, while lighter items like spices or utensils can be stored in smaller wire baskets or racks. Cabinet doors come in different sizes and types, so make sure to measure the space before purchasing any storage solutions. With careful planning and organization, utilizing the space on cabinet doors is an excellent way to addition to help with storage in your kitchen.

Make Use of Wall Shelving and Hooks

Vertical storage solutions such as wall shelving and hooks are another great option for keeping clutter off the counters. By using the walls to store items, you can free up space and keep your kitchen clean. Wall shelving can be used to store dishes, glasses, and cooking utensils. Look for shelves with a weight capacity that can handle the items you want to store. Adjustable shelves are even better, as they allow you to customize the space according to your needs. Hooks are also useful for hanging pots, pans, and even coffee mugs. When choosing the right size and type of shelving or hook for different kinds of kitchen items, consider the weight and dimensions of the items. Smaller hooks are perfect for lighter kitchen items, such as utensils or oven mitts, while larger hooks are better suited to hold heavier items like pots and pans. Make sure to choose hooks and shelves that can withstand the weight of the items you need to store. By making use of wall shelving and hooks, you can optimize the storage space in your kitchen while keeping everything within reach. Incorporate Drawer Dividers and Inserts

If your kitchen drawers are a jumble of utensils and spices, incorporating drawer dividers and inserts can be a game-changer. By creating separate compartments for different items, you can maximize storage space and make it easier to find what you need quickly. Adjustable dividers are particularly useful as they can be customized to fit your specific items. Utensil organizers can keep your spoons, forks, and knives neatly in place, while spice racks can keep your seasonings organized and accessible. Another benefit of using dividers and inserts is that they prevent items from moving around in the drawer, reducing the risk of damage or breakage. Plus, having designated spaces for each item makes it easier to maintain an organized and tidy kitchen. Don’t underestimate the importance of organization in the kitchen.
